This letter reports upon transport properties of the (EDT-TTF)2 [Pd(dmit)2]2 compound. A nonlinear effect is observed below 50 K at ambient pressure. A resistivity bump, observed at ca. 40 K at ambient pressure, is shifted towards lower temperature under pressure and a metallic ground state is stabilized up to 10 kbar. In order to understand lack of superconductivity above 500 mK, low-dimensional electronic correlations are stressed on.
